Is it possible to avoid conflict in the workplace and socially? In this engaging interactive talk, Peter Kerry provides practical solutions in conflict management. He considers the following points:

  • Early intervention that protects people and organisations

  • Early warning signs

  • Manager responsibility vs HR escalation

  • Cost, time, and reputational impact

About Peter Kerry

Peter Kerry is a UK-accredited Workplace, Civil and Commercial Mediator and professional speaker who works with organisations to improve communication, reduce unnecessary conflict, and address issues early before they escalate.

Drawing on real-world workplace experience, Peter’s talks are practical, grounded, and focused on everyday challenges faced by managers and teams. His sessions help audiences improve listening, handle difficult conversations more confidently, and communicate more clearly under pressure.

Peter regularly works with professional, corporate, and public-sector audiences and adapts his content to suit the size, sector, and objectives of each event.
